Lucky skywatchers in certain parts of the globe have today (June 21st) been treated to a dramatic solar eclipse.

This time lapse clip was filmed in the Philippines at around 1 pm local time today.

The phenomenon is called an annular eclipse or ring of fire where the moon passes between the Earth and the Sun, leaving just a thin ring of light visible.
